Understanding the difference between eUICC and eSIM is key to avoiding confusion when associating these two concepts. They are often referred to as the same, but the truth is that they are two different tech solutions with separate but complementary functionalities.

The eSIM is the digital version of a physical SIM card. The eSIM is smaller than a nano-SIM and is embedded in the motherboard of compatible cellphones. In other words, the user doesn't have to insert or remove a SIM card to connect to a carrier's cellular network, as this switch is done remotely.
Until recently, cellular providers had full control over the services offered to the user. However, thanks to the eSIM, this process has changed significantly. Due to its compatibility with any cellular network, the user can choose the services and networks they wish to connect to at any certain time, regardless of whether they are domestic or foreign networks.
But how is this possible? Let's find out with the eUICC.
The Universal Integrated Circuit Card (eUICC) is software that enables the storage of multiple network profiles with a single SIM. Moreover, it allows their exchange through the use of Over the Air (OTA) technology, so it’s possible to carry out this process wirelessly, without physically opening up the device.
To put it another way, the eUICC is placed on the device's motherboard hardware and serves as a container that securely stores the eSIM profiles on the phone. However, one should not make assumptions, as not all eSIMs are equipped with eUICC; and in turn, some physical SIMs may mimic this function in dual-SIM cellphones.
As you may note, there is a difference between eUICC and eSIM. But it’s so small that even companies that offer IoT connectivity and mobile devices with physical or embedded SIM cards often confuse them. So, to clear this up, we can think of eSIM as the whole ecosystem of services that allows the user to sign up for plans from different carriers and eSIM providers.
Whereas the eUICC allows the storage of multiple network operator profiles and enables their exchange so that the user can access the cellular services subscribed through each of these eSIM profiles, with no need to handle a physical chip; only by adjusting the settings of the smartphone.

International roaming is the service that mobile operators offer to continue using their services abroad.

To find safe WiFi networks we recommend you choose the ones offered by hotels, cafés, or restaurants. It is also important to make sure that the networks are protected by a password and employ a VPN to protect their data and security.
A local SIM card is bought in the country you visit, and it is used to have mobile data and local services. An international SIM card lets you use cellular data services without having to change your SIM card. International SIM cards usually have specific plans and prices for travelers.

As a last alternative, we have the option of buying a tourist SIM card locally when we arrive in Canada. This must be done through a Canadian operator, which has stores throughout the country that we can go to. Three of the major phone companies are Rogers, Telus, and Freedom Mobile, all of which have SIM cards that foreigners can purchase.
You should remember that the options for tourists are reduced compared to the plans for residents, so you should choose the one you find convenient. You will also often be asked for personal information and valid documents to proceed with the purchase. Once you purchase the SIM card, you must register it as the law requires. In some cases, you may be asked to confirm the IMEI of your phone and its compatibility with local networks.
One of the first steps to buying a prepaid SIM card locally in Canada is to look for physical stores of any of these three operators. The first place to find them is at the airport. For example, Toronto Pearson Airport has phone and technology stores in its terminals selling SIM cards for tourists.
We can also find options in the city where you arrive, from supermarkets, electronics stores, and branches of the operators, even franchises like 7-Eleven sell these SIM cards for you! We recommend you use the maps that the phone companies have to locate the options you can take before arriving and have an overview of where to go.
We have talked so far about three Canadian operators, but in the country, there are other options known as MVNOs from which you can buy prepaid SIM cards. Despite this, they all use the same main networks, so the costs of their services are very similar.
In Canada, you can pay 30$ for basic text, calls, and data options for tourists. Up to $55 for options with more data in case you are a more demanding user. All plans available are for use within thirty days, and there are no unlimited data options for tourists, only plans with 8GB of browsing maximum. Only for postpaid customers will we find plans with unlimited data.

The last way we have as visitors in Miami is to buy a local SIM card once we arrive. Operators such as AT&T, T-Mobile, and Verizon are the most important in the country and have excellent service and coverage in Miami. If you buy a tourist SIM card with any of these three, you will have assured your communication during your trip.
You should know that you must undergo a SIM registration process when you buy one of these SIM cards. Generally, in the store where you make the purchase, they will help you with this, considering that it may take some time. You will also need to have a valid ID and a valid payment method from the store. You will not have mobile internet until you have completed the purchase and installed the SIM card in your phone.

AT&T, T-Mobile, and Verizon are the largest mobile operators in the country also have a variety of physical stores in the city. To locate them more quickly, you can use the maps on their websites to find the physical stores in the city. You can also find options at Miami International Airport, although depending on your arrival time, the stores may or may not be open. With any of the options, you will not be able to bypass the registration process.
You may think that using a local operator will give you better service than using an international SIM card. The truth is that the SIM cards you buy in the online stores use these local networks to work, so with either option, you will be connected to an excellent network service.
The cost of the SIM card for Miami will depend directly on the prepaid plan you purchase with it. It is impossible to purchase a SIM card without an associated plan as a tourist in the city. The price range you can expect is from $25 for a basic option and up to $60 for more complete plans. All options are for use in one month, so if your stay is shorter, you will have to pay extra.
In some cases, in addition to your documentation, you will be asked to bring your mobile phone, where you will place the SIM card. The operator must confirm that the SIM card can be used in the phone before selling it.
